Transaction 6278646f2f876a976da4f2fe82925862d3690b42667b88ea1b615bf222a89730

1 Input
2 Outputs
  • 6278646f2f876a976da4f2fe82925862d3690b42667b88ea1b615bf222a89730:0
  • value  844653966
    address  3CSCCmRVudZGM9dPW9iiVciSVB6s6ffgbk
  • 6278646f2f876a976da4f2fe82925862d3690b42667b88ea1b615bf222a89730:1
  • value  2238950
    address  3MZMtTk6HKoTeUtubNmRLgJ5nyLpw8qMQ7